C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ED Fully Automatic: Quick, Reliable, and User-Friendly Emergency Response

The C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ED Fully Automatic defibrillator is engineered to deliver fast and effective emergency cardiac care with minimal user intervention. This state-of-the-art device is equipped with advanced technology to ensure effective defibrillation in both public and professional settings. Its fully automatic operation means that the iPAD SP1 automatically assesses the patient’s heart rhythm and delivers shocks without any user input, making it an ideal choice for emergencies where every second counts, even for individuals without prior CPR or first aid training.

 

Key Features of the C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ED:

  • Fully Automatic Operation: The iPAD SP1 automatically analyzes the patient’s condition and delivers a shock when necessary, allowing for swift and effective intervention during cardiac emergencies.

  • User-Friendly Guidance: The device provides clear voice prompts and visual instructions, making it easy for both lay users and trained professionals to operate during emergencies, ensuring a confident and quick response.

  • Integrated Metronome: The built-in metronome assists rescuers in maintaining the optimal chest compression rate, enhancing the effectiveness of CPR efforts.

  • Internal Memory: The iPAD SP1 records critical data such as time, date, ECG traces, shock delivery details, and CPR intervals, ensuring comprehensive documentation of each event for quality assurance and review.

  • USB Data Port: Facilitates seamless data transfer and analysis for record-keeping and continuous improvement in emergency response.

  • Automatic Self-Testing: Conducts regular self-checks with a visual readiness indicator, ensuring the device is functioning correctly and ready for use.

  • Durable & Rugged Design: The iPAD SP1 is designed with an IP55 rating, providing excellent protection against dust and water, making it suitable for various environments, including outdoor settings.

  • Long Battery Life: The defibrillator features a reliable, long-lasting battery capable of delivering multiple shocks, ensuring it remains ready for use in both high-traffic and low-traffic areas.

Detailed Technical Information

Product Exterior
Dimension: 260 x 256 x 70 mm (Width x Length x Height)
Weight: Appr. 2.4kg (Including battery pack and pads) .

 

Defibrillator
Operating Mode: Semi-automated, Full-automated
Waveform: e-cube biphasic (Truncated exponential type)
Output Energy: 150 J at 50 A load for Adults, 50 J at 50 A load for Children .

 

Self-Diagnostic Test
Auto
Power On Self-Test, Run-time Self-Test
Daily, Weekly, and Monthly Self-Test
Manual
Battery Pack Insertion Test (done when the user inserts the battery pack into the battery pack compartment of the device).

 

ECG Analysis System
Fucntion: Determines the impedance of the patient and evaluates the ECG of the patient to determine whether it is shockable or non-shockable
Impedance Range: 25? ~ 175? .

 

Control Devices, Indicators, Voice Instructions
Control Devices Power Button, i-Button, Shock Button, Adult/Pediatric Selection Switch
Status LCD Displays device status, battery level and pads status
CPR Detection Indicator: Lights if CPR is detected; flashes if CPR is not detected..

 

Disposable Battery Pack
Battery Type: 12V DC, 4.2Ah LiMnO2, Disposable
Capacity: At least 200 shocks for a new battery or 8 hours of operating time at room temperature

 

Temperature
Operating: Temperature: 0? ~ 43? (32? ~ 109?)
Storage: Temperature: -20? ~ 60? (-4? ~ 140?).

 

Electrode


Adult
Electrode Area : 110cm2
Cable Length: Total 120cm
Paediatric
Electrode Area: 50cm2
Cable Length: Total 120cm.

 

Data Storage and Transfer
Internal Memory Data Capacity: 5 individual treatments, up to 3 hours per treatment
IrDA: For PC communications
SD Card External memory: Data may be copied from the internal memory to the SD Card

1. How does the CU Medical iPAD SP1 Fully Automatic AED ensure user confidence?
The CU Medical iPAD SP1 Fully Automatic AED boosts user confidence with clear, step-by-step voice prompts and visual indicators. These intuitive guides support even untrained users through the entire defibrillation process. The device is fully automatic, meaning it delivers a shock without needing the user to press a button, reducing stress and hesitation in emergencies. 2. Is the C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ED suitable for outdoor environments?
Yes, the iPAD SP1 AED is designed to withstand challenging conditions, making it ideal for outdoor and public settings. It features a tough casing and an IP55 rating, offering protection against dust and water. This makes it suitable for locations such as sports facilities, construction sites, parks, and public venues. 4. What is the battery life of the C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ED?
The C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ED is equipped with a reliable, long-life battery that offers up to five years of standby life. The device performs daily self-tests to ensure battery and pad readiness. 5. Can the C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ED be used on children?
Yes, the iPAD SP1 AED includes a built-in paediatric switch, allowing rescuers to change the mode from adult to child without switching the pads. This makes it an excellent choice for schools, leisure centres, and other public venues. 6. How often should I service or maintain the CU Medical iPAD SP1 AED?
The iPAD SP1 AED requires minimal maintenance, but regular checks are essential. We recommend inspecting the battery, pads, and device status at least once a month. Pads should be replaced before their expiry date, and the battery should be replaced every 4 to 5 years, depending on use.
